Risk Modelling Services, Actuarial P&C Senior Associate (Bilingual FR/EN)
Posted 13 days ago
Job Description
As a Risk Modelling Services, Actuarial P&C Senior Associate, you'll work as part of a team of problem solvers, helping to find solutions to complex business issues from strategy to execution.
Meaningful work you'll be a part of
• Supporting teams in a broad range of actuarial consulting services and transformation initiatives
• Work closely with our senior actuaries on our appointed actuary services including actuarial liability valuation and financial condition testing, product development, advisory services, and insurance accounting standards (IFRS 17)
• Support the team in our audit support services including re-performing the actuarial liabilities valuation, and reviewing valuation methodologies and assumptions
• Analyzing client information in order to conclude whether the actuarial liabilities are fairly presented in the financial statements
• Supporting clients with their modelling needs for climate, cyber, and insurance pricing
• Collaborate with other actuaries on a variety of projects, including cross-functional projects with other departments within PwC
• Support relationship building with our clients
• Share findings and recommendations to non actuarial teams in a clear and non-technical manner
• Support and help upskill junior staff
Experiences and skills you'll use to solve
• Progressive experience in the P&C insurance industry including policy liability valuation, financial condition testing, IFRS 17, pricing, or predictive modeling
• Actively pursuing Canadian Institute of Actuaries qualification of FCIA
• Commitment to providing excellent client service, by building and maintaining productive relationships with both internal and external clients
• Advanced analytical, problem solving and multitasking/project management skills
• Proficiency in reserving or statistical applications such as Arius, R, or Python
• Proven ability working with data analytic tools (Tableau, Alteryx, VBA) considered an asset
• Continuous improvement mind-set, challenges the status quo and seeks self-improvement
• Strong written and oral communication skills, including experience presenting in a business context
• Prior experience within a consulting or advisory role (or capable to work in a consulting/audit environments and project-based work) considered an asset
• A demonstrated commitment to valuing differences and working alongside and/or coaching diverse people and perspectives
• PwC Canada is committed to cultivating an inclusive, hybrid work environment. Exact expectations for your team can be discussed with your interviewer
• The successful candidate requires fluency in English, in addition to French as they will be required to support or collaborate with English-speaking clients, colleagues and/or stakeholders during the course of their employment with PwC Canada

The salary range for this position is $84,700 - $134,700. The posted salary range represents the expected hiring range for PwC locations in major city centres. Given our national recruiting approach, ranges may vary for positions in other locations. At PwC Canada, base salary is determined by your skills, experience, qualifications and work location.
